#193485 Hex color

#193485

The hexadecimal color code #193485 corresponds to the code RGB( 25, 52, 133 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,10 level), green (at 0,20 level) and blue (at 0,52 level). Its brightness is 30% and its saturation is 68%. It is composed of red at 11%, green at 24% and blue at 63%. The dominant component is blue.
